- 博客(8)
- 收藏
- 关注
原创 如何利用GPT们解决关于文本处理的重复性工作?
合理利用GPT类AI模型的文本处理和代码生成能力,可以简化和自动化重复性的文本处理工作,从而提高工作效率。
2024-04-16 00:42:50
319
原创 Docker和JVM应用OOM那些事
Java 应用运行过程中你是否遇到以下类似问题为什么 Java 应用所在的 Docker 容器内存使用量不会减少?发生 OOM 后程序还能运行吗?Java 应用所在的容器为什么宕机或者自动重启了?三个问题有一定关联性,在回答以上问题前,我们先了解下“OOM”和“JVM 内存管理”。
2023-07-03 18:31:31
2373
原创 测试框架平台对比 Java VS NodeJS
引言近期遇到部分Java后端团队使用NodeJS做单元测试,由此产生疑问用NodeJS更优吗?Java自己不香了吗?本文在此做初步的分析和探讨。分析过程Java框架选型除了常规的JUnit外,目前比较火热的就是TestNG(用例管理、并行执行、自动生成HTML测试报告、端到端/集成测试)。丰富的Mock工具传送门>>:基于动态代理的 Mokito。基于自定义类加载器的 PowerMock。基于动态字节码修改的 JMockit。阿里基于动态字节码修改的 TestableMo
2021-11-22 09:03:10
519
原创 定时作业数据加工如何写?
文章目录概述案例问题分析推荐写法基类抽象写法其它思考概述生产开发过程经常遇到数据加工场景,如果处理不好很容易引起各种问题,比如:加工慢、漏加工等,本文针对常见的无序加工场景进行分析介绍。案例先看一段目前主流的加工代码,以下代码存在一些坑。题外话:还有些童鞋使用了死循环取数加工,取不到数据时跳出循环或者休眠指定时间,普通业务场景不推荐。 public void doExecute() { ... try { long count = getBillRep
2021-08-14 09:42:20
106
原创 需求分析设计之七武器
文章目录1. 概述2. 工具选型2.1. UML工具2.2. 设计编写工具2.2.1. 功能诉求2.2.2. 工具选择3. “七武器”使用示例3.1. 类图3.1.1. 对象图刻画领域模型3.1.2. 类图刻画代码模型3.2. 活动图3.3. 状态图3.4. 时序图3.5. 组件图3.6. 部署图3.7. 用例图1. 概述软件建模与设计过程可拆分为需求分析、概要设计和详细设计三个阶段。我们往往需要在不同阶段输出不同的设计文档。这个过程,除了自身的业务理解能力外,建模工具UML必不可少,其中常用的有七种(
2021-08-14 09:37:37
551
1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人